Brent Morel has been on the disabled list since May 18 with a Lumbar back strain, but he began his rehab assignment at Triple-A Charlotte Wednesday night and immediately showed signs he's healthy.

Morel went 2 for 3 with a double in five innings Wednesday night and followed that up with a 2 for 5 performance Thursday. He'll get at least one more game in Friday before the White Sox will be faced with a roster decision when Morel is eligible to come off the disabled list Saturday.

Orlando Hudson is experiencing his first taste at the hot corner, but is hitting just .185 with a double, triple and four RBIs in nine games with the White Sox. Meanwhile, Morel was hitting just .177 with zero home runs, two doubles and five RBIs when he was placed on the 15-day disabled list.

Whenever the Sox choose to activate Morel, Eduardo Escobar could be sent down. Escobar, 23, is hitting .140 with one RBI in 15 games and has played just once since May 19.
